* Variation of patch # 1624059 to speed up checking if an object is a subclassNeal Norwitz2007-02-251-1/+1
| | | | | | | | | | | | | | | | | | of some of the common builtin types. Use a bit in tp_flags for each common builtin type. Check the bit to determine if any instance is a subclass of these common types. The check avoids a function call and O(n) search of the base classes. The check is done in the various Py*_Check macros rather than calling PyType_IsSubtype(). All the bits are set in tp_flags when the type is declared in the Objects/*object.c files because PyType_Ready() is not called for all the types. Should PyType_Ready() be called for all types? If so and the change is made, the changes to the Objects/*object.c files can be reverted (remove setting the tp_flags). Objects/typeobject.c would also have to be modified to add conditions for Py*_CheckExact() in addition to each the PyType_IsSubtype check.

* PyLong_FromString(): Continued fraction analysis (explained inTim Peters2006-05-301-3/+74
| | | | | | | | | | | | a new comment) suggests there are almost certainly large input integers in all non-binary input bases for which one Python digit too few is initally allocated to hold the final result. Instead of assert-failing when that happens, allocate more space. Alas, I estimate it would take a few days to find a specific such case, so this isn't backed up by a new test (not to mention that such a case may take hours to run, since conversion time is quadratic in the number of digits, and preliminary attempts suggested that the smallest such inputs contain at least a million digits).

* Heavily fiddled variant of patch #1442927: PyLong_FromString optimization.Tim Peters2006-05-241-44/+156
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| ``long(str, base)`` is now up to 6x faster for non-power-of-2 bases. The largest speedup is for inputs with about 1000 decimal digits. Conversion from non-power-of-2 bases remains quadratic-time in the number of input digits (it was and remains linear-time for bases 2, 4, 8, 16 and 32). Speedups at various lengths for decimal inputs, comparing 2.4.3 with current trunk. Note that it's actually a bit slower for 1-digit strings: len speedup ---- ------- 1 -4.5% 2 4.6% 3 8.3% 4 12.7% 5 16.9% 6 28.6% 7 35.5% 8 44.3% 9 46.6% 10 55.3% 11 65.7% 12 77.7% 13 73.4% 14 75.3% 15 85.2% 16 103.0% 17 95.1% 18 112.8% 19 117.9% 20 128.3% 30 174.5% 40 209.3% 50 236.3% 60 254.3% 70 262.9% 80 295.8% 90 297.3% 100 324.5% 200 374.6% 300 403.1% 400 391.1% 500 388.7% 600 440.6% 700 468.7% 800 498.0% 900 507.2% 1000 501.2% 2000 450.2% 3000 463.2% 4000 452.5% 5000 440.6% 6000 439.6% 7000 424.8% 8000 418.1% 9000 417.7%

* Fix int() and long() to repr() their argument when formatting the exception,Thomas Wouters2006-04-111-2/+14
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| to avoid confusing situations like: >>> int("") ValueError: invalid literal for int(): >>> int("2\n\n2") ValueError: invalid literal for int(): 2 2 Also report the base used, to avoid: ValueError: invalid literal for int(): 2 They now report: >>> int("") ValueError: invalid literal for int() with base 10: '' >>> int("2\n\n2") ValueError: invalid literal for int() with base 10: '2\n\n2' >>> int("2", 2) ValueError: invalid literal for int() with base 2: '2' (Reporting the base could be avoided when base is 10, which is the default, but hrm.) Another effect of these changes is that the errormessage can be longer; before, it was cut off at about 250 characters. Now, it can be up to four times as long, as the unrepr'ed string is cut off at 200 characters, instead. No tests were added or changed, since testing for exact errormsgs is (pardon the pun) somewhat errorprone, and I consider not testing the exact text preferable. The actually changed code is tested frequent enough in the test_builtin test as it is (120 runs for each of ints and longs.)
